    • Embodiments of the invention determine whether speaker earbuds of a headset are positioned in a user's ears. The headset may be a “Y” shaped headset with two earbuds having speakers and a plug for insertion into a jack of the audio device. Multiple microphones are located on wired lengths to the earbuds and a common wire between the lengths and the plug, to receive speech from the user's mouth. Each earbud may have a front and rear microphone, and an accelerometer. Embodiments can detect user speech vibrations at one or more of the microphones, and in the accelerometers in the earbuds. Based on these detections, it can be determined whether one or both of the earbuds are in user's ears. To provide more accurate beamforming, when only one of the earbuds is in the user's ears, only the microphones leading to that earbud are selected for beamforming input.
    • 本发明的实施例确定耳机的扬声器耳塞是否位于用户的耳朵中。 耳机可以是具有两个具有扬声器的耳塞的“Y”形耳机,以及用于插入到音频设备的插孔中的插头。 多个麦克风位于耳机的有线长度上,长度和插头之间有一条公共线,用于从用户口中接收语音。 每个耳塞可能有一个前后麦克风和一个加速度计。 实施例可以在一个或多个麦克风以及耳塞中的加速度计中检测用户语音振动。 基于这些检测,可以确定耳塞中的一个或两个是否在用户的耳朵中。 为了提供更准确的波束成形,当只有一个耳塞在用户的耳朵中时,仅选择导致该耳塞的麦克风用于波束成形输入。
